In Kazakhstan civil servants will be accountable for substandard services

Kazakhstan, Astana, 21 January / Trend D. Mukhtarov /

In Kazakhstan, civil servants will bear responsibility for for poor quality government services, the deputy head of the Presidential Administration Baurzhan Baibek reported on Friday.

He recalled that in past few years steps taken for improvement of provision of public service delivery gave positive results.

"People felt those results on the example of PSC (Public Service Centers - Trend). Though their performance is far from being perfect, still people saw and felt that many of the services (registration, cancellation of registration, obtaining driver license, etc) may be performed quickly and efficiently, " he said.

According to him, the law is primarily directed to the fact that all of the complaints of citizens should be considered on time by government agencies, all the stages of application consideration must be transparent.

As previously reported, the President signed the Law on "Amendments and additions to some legislative acts of the Republic of Kazakhstan for the public service" on Friday.

The law aims at improving the efficiency of the state apparatus, including through the introduction of new mechanisms for the formation, operation and evaluation of personnel of public service.
